Subject: Re: [PATCH] virtio-net: support the outer source port hash for UDP-encapsulated packets
On Fri, Jul 28, 2023 at 04:46:35PM +0800, Heng Qi wrote: > UDP tunneling protocols usually identify a flow using the outer source UDP > port, which is useful for processing UDP-encapsulated packets, such as > increasing entropy for RSS queue selection or hashing the same flow to the > same receive queue. Therefore, we extend it as a new RSS configuration. > that's not a real motivation is it? it's already included for increasing entropy. the real motivation is ignoring source and destination ip because they can change if tunneling gateway changes, right? > Signed-off-by: Heng Qi <hengqi@linux.alibaba.com> > Reviewed-by: Xuan Zhuo <xuanzhuo@linux.alibaba.com> > --- >
